It is a container usually used for holding gases ( gas tank ) and
sometimes liquids. This term can be used for reservoir also. They
operate under very little pressure. They are available in various
shapes most oftenly they are cylindrical in shape. They are
perpendicular to the ground with flat bottom and a fixed roof is there.
Depending on the nature of the fluid contained in the storage tanks ,
various environmental regulation are applied to the design and operation
of them. Large storage tanks tend to be in cylindrical in shape or rounded corners so that they can withstand hydraulic pressure of contained liquid. Tanker is a large storage tank which is mounted on a lorry trailer. They are insulated and double walled to ensure safety. Their capacities ranges from approximately hundreds of gallons to thousands of barrels. They are designed such that they are easily mounted in fixed locations as stationary vessels , truck chassis or on railroad car for easy transportation.
Basic categories of Storage Tanks
There are two basic categories of storage tanks for gases and liquids.
Aboveground storage tanks (AST) and Underground storage tanks (UST)- Both of them differ in the way of regulations applied on both of them.
Types of Storage Tank
These are mostly above ground storage tanks and they are :
- High Pressure Storage Tanks : These are
designed and used to withstand immense pressure exerted by the
content. They can be called as cylinders.
- Mobile "Storage" Tanks : They are
specially designed to deal with heavy sloshing load or the risk of
collision . They are sometimes used as LNG carriers. They are mostly
used as highway traveling tankers.
- Insulated CO2 Storage Tanks : They are
designed for bulk storage of CO2 gas. They are fabricated under
internationally approved inspection agencies. They are designed in
such a way that they prevent even the smallest loss of gas by
evaporation.
- Transportable Storage Tanker : They are made to BS-5500. They are vacuum insulated and they are suitable for transportation by road, ship or rail.
